Before the first light could stream through the windows of Detroit Animal Care and Control, an early morning twist of fate unfolded.
A volunteer, greeted by a man with dogs to surrender, stepped away momentarily, only to return to a mystery—the man had disappeared. But this was no ordinary day; it was a day of discovery and hope.

In the shelter’s play area, two little souls huddled against the cold metal of a fence, their tiny bodies trembling—not from the chill, but from fear.
The staff of the shelter, upon finding the pair, embarked on a thorough search, reminiscent of a treasure hunt, but with stakes much higher. They were searching for life, for hope, for any other puppies that might have been left behind.
The search concluded with just the two puppies, who were then whisked away to safety and comfort. With bellies filled and spirits lifted, Zeus and SpongeBob, as they were affectionately named, began to show their true colors.
Zeus, with his chocolate coat, found his forever home swiftly—a testament to the love that awaited him. SpongeBob, with a name as playful as his demeanor, continued to seek a family to call his own.
In the warmth of the shelter, with toys and treats aplenty, the puppies’ transformation was a sight to behold. From trembling to playful frolics, their journey was a reminder of the resilience of the canine spirit and the compassion of those who care for them.
